Randgold may be delisted in the US
Posted Thu, 21 Jul 2005
Randgold and Exploration said in a statement on Wednesday it faces being delisted from the Nasdaq stock exchange after failing to comply with the exchange's requirements for continued listing.
The company received a notice from the Nasdaq stating that its securities are subject to delisting as a result of Randgold and Exploration failing to timeously file its Form 20-F for the year to December 31, 2004.
Randgold noted that the notice itself does not result in the immediate delisting from the Nasdaq and that the company would make a timely request for a hearing with the Nasdaq Listing Qualifications Panel to review the matter.
The company did note however that there were no assurances that the qualifications panel would allow the group to continue to list.
Randgold said the company had experienced delays in obtaining information to finalise its audited financial statements.
